For those planning their travel from Southall, the station provides an assortment of facilities to ensure a seamless experience. The ticket office operates from 06:30 to 19:30 on weekdays and Saturdays, with shorter hours on Sundays from 08:10 to 15:30. Ticket machines are available for collecting pre-booked tickets, making it a breeze to manage your travel plans.
Accessibility is a priority at Southall Station, where you'll find step-free access to all platforms, making it easy for individuals with mobility challenges to navigate the station. Additionally, staff ramp assistance and wheelchairs are on hand throughout the day to offer further support. The station offers accessible ticket machines and induction loops to ensure everyone can travel with ease and independence.
If you need to freshen up before your journey, Southall has you covered with male, female, and accessible toilets. Baby changing facilities are also available for families traveling with little ones. While there may not be refreshment facilities or shops directly within the station, the vibrant locale just beyond the station doors offers plenty of options for dining and shopping.
In terms of connectivity, Southall provides numerous links to alternative transportation for those seeking onward travel. Nearby bus services operated by Transport for London offer easy access across the city, with routes and schedules available to plan your journey further. If you're heading towards Heathrow Airport, the Elizabeth Line provides direct service; alternatively, you can take the 482 bus for a hassle-free trip.
For any unexpected service disruptions, the rail replacement service ensures you stay on track with your travel plans, connecting passengers towards Paddington and Slough with convenient stops located right outside the station. For maps and planning information, click here.

Layton (Lancs) is a rather modest station, reflecting the quiet and tranquil nature of its surroundings. It does not boast a ticket office or ticket machines, so purchasing and collecting tickets prior to arriving at the station is essential. Nonetheless, there's an emphasis on accessibility, as there are step-free accesses via ramps onto both platforms. However, moving between platforms requires navigating a series of steps.
Despite the absence of staffed help, the station responds to the needs of all travelers by enabling assistance through conductors on trains. CCTV cameras are installed for added security, and while there's no formal waiting room, a seating area is available. Unfortunately, refreshment facilities, ATMs, and bicycles storage are not available, reminding travelers to plan accordingly before arrival.
Transportation from Layton (Lancs) extends beyond rail services, providing essential links to various modes of travel. Bus services are conveniently located nearby on Benson Road, ensuring a seamless transition from train to local destinations. Although there's no on-site bicycle hire, helpful taxi services can be arranged via Northern Railway's Cab4You, making onward journeys effortless for travelers.
